Niles rolls to 9-0

Published 4:50 pm Friday, September 26, 2003

By By SCOTT NOVAK / Niles Daily Star
DOWAGIAC -- For one quarter Thursday night the Dowagiac varsity basketball team followed coach Joe Spitale's game plan to a tee.
The Chieftains held Niles to just six points and trailed the No. 3-ranked Lady Vikings, 6-4.
Then came the second quarter.
Niles outscored Dowagiac 55-14 over the final three periods of the Big-16 Conference West Division contest to score a 61-18 victory.
Dowagiac has struggled throughout the season in the third quarter. The same was true Thursday night as Niles outscored Dowagiac 24-5 to take a commanding 45-14 lead entering the final period.
The Lady Vikings settled down, clamped down on the Chieftains defensively and turned the game into a rout.
Dowagiac turned the ball over just 11 times in the opening half, but committed 19 turnovers in the final 16 minutes to contribute to the lopsided loss.
Niles sophomore Sarah Dreher really picked up the slack for the loss of standout Amber Peters to an ankle injury. Peters injured her ankle Tuesday night in the Vikings' 66-52 win over Benton Harbor.
Dreher led all scorers with 17 points.
Niles also got 12 points each from sophomore Brandie Radde and senior Ashley Spriggs.
Dowagiac had just three players score in the contest as Brittney Reist led the way with nine points. Brianne Reist finished with six points and Holly Lowe three.
The Niles junior varsity basketball team beat Dowagiac 50-20, led by 10 points each from Jessica Shinsky and Chardae Ross. The Vikings are now 8-1 on the year.
The Niles freshmen basketball team beat Dowagiac 41-19. Torii Mitchell led the Vikings with 10 points.
